Scammers are great at impersonating government agencies and well-known brands to lure email recipients into giving up their personal information. Then they take the information and exploited it directly or sell it to the highest bidder on the Dark Web.
Security firm Checkpoint is tracking which brands/companies are imitated the most. Quite often Microsoft tops the list but this year they’ve been dethroned by shipping company DHL. That may not be surprising given the realities of the pandemic and the rise in popularity of online shopping.
Here is the list of the top ten for this year from their report:
- DHL (impersonated in 23 percent of all phishing attacks, globally)
- Microsoft (20 percent)
- WhatsApp (11 percent)
- Google (10 percent)
- LinkedIn (8 percent)
- Amazon (4 percent)
